5.1 Insight Control for Linux installation overview
The Insight Control for Linux distribution medium contains the following software products and
documentation:
Systems Insight Manager
Insight Control for Linux
The source code for the third-party open source products that are integrated with Insight Control
for Linux
A file named README.mht in the HP directory that describes how to obtain the Insight Control
for Linux documentation set and the documentation for related products
To begin the installation process, you:
1. Set the umask for root to 0022. Other umask values will likely cause Nagios and other
components of Insight Control for Linux to be misconfigured.
2. Mount the Insight Control for Linux distribution medium for this release.
3. Run the install.sh Insight Control for Linux installation script on the server you have
prepared and configured to be the CMS.
For the list of CMS installation requirements, see Section 3.4 (page 14).
The first phase of the install.sh script determines if Systems Insight Manager and Insight Control
for Linux are already installed on the CMS. The HP Insight Control for Linux Support Matrix lists
the action taken by the install.sh script when it finds previously installed versions of Systems
Insight Manager, Insight Control for Linux, or both.
Next, the installation script verifies that all required RPMs are installed on the CMS. If an RPM
requirement is not installed, the installation script stops so that you can install the missing RPMs.
After you install all RPM requirements and dependencies, you must start the Insight Control for
Linux installation script again.
When all RPM dependencies are met, the installation process proceeds, and you are prompted
to answer a series of configuration questions, which are described in Section 5.2 (page 37).
